Transaction 57c32c1be13691d18ab7d0014eee88f363588163adb622976375b48270acfcdf

20 Input
2 Outputs
  • 57c32c1be13691d18ab7d0014eee88f363588163adb622976375b48270acfcdf:0
  • value  637600
    address  16pcdGeZ42oJDq1oWfYArmcoAsKaxoSFa6
  • 57c32c1be13691d18ab7d0014eee88f363588163adb622976375b48270acfcdf:1
  • value  5459992
    address  36Br73Ba3uJy3MzxjCsnkkN8ug956jRpG5